So you guys scared the shit out of me this winter with all your talk of rusty longitudinals (sp?). So tis weekend i yanked off the rocker covers on my car, which has lived all of it's 29 years in Chicago. After clearing out at least 5 pounds of rocks, dirt, and tire marbles, it turns out that miricales can happen. This shot is after washing. I think that i will hit it with some POR 15, and put the rocker covers back on. At least one less thing to worry about!
